_Longing_

The need   
The need is dire   
The need to crave   
 Drained of body   
 And of mind   
 The need controls   
 Body succumb   
To the need

The craving   
 The craving in need   
 To crave what's pure   
 Body is mind   
 Body is broken   
 Craving shudders   
 Mind crashing   
To the craving

The want   
 The want for love   
The want to learn   
 Accept surroundings   
 Drink in the light   
 The want complies   
 Thoughts determined   
Of the want

The desire   
 The desire for need   
 The desire for others   
Corrupt in thought   
Breaking, eroding   
 Desire the embers   
Ideas compelled   
For the desire

The need is constant   
The cravings are instant   
The want is calling   
 Body sighs   
 Mind listens   
 Desire is screaming   
 This is evident:   
Patience in Longing.

~bhscorch
